Heaven begets all things to nurture mankind, yet mankind offers nothing in return to the heavens. In the vast and primeval cosmos, countless living beings know only how to take and never to give back, devouring without gratitude. Thus, the very source of all creation wanes, treading the path of decline and demise. Owing to a jade palace imbued with the aura of the Primal Chaos Green Lotus, Qingxuan is reborn in this primordial world. Blessed by the fortune of the Chaos Green Lotus and sheltered by Pangu himself, he casts himself into the nurturing of the desolate earth. Determined to shatter the shackles of fate, to seek enlightenment, ascend to the pinnacle, and ultimately transcend, Qingxuan gradually awakens through a series of fateful encounters. With each revelation, he schemes to reshape the primeval world, to restore its essence and elevate its destiny. Witness how, with a single stroke of fortune, steadfast resolve, and unwavering faith, he comes to comprehend the heart of heaven and earth, alters the course of the world, shifts the tides of fate, and guides all creation toward the path of transcendence.

Volume One: The Lich Cataclysm Chapter 101: Tasting Fruit and Discussing the Dao, Hongyun Learns a Secret

"Enough of this talk. Since you have come to visit me, my friend, why not sample some of the fruits from my garden?" With these words, Zhenyuanzi led Hongyun into the main hall. With a casual wave of his hand, several ginseng fruits appeared upon the table.

“Please, my friend. This is the spiritual fruit borne of my companion root, known as the Ginseng Fruit, also called the Grass Elixir. In the beginning, it would blossom every three thousand years, bear fruit for three thousand, and require a further three thousand to ripen. Thus, more than ten thousand years would pass before a crop of thirty fruits could be harvested.”

Here, Zhenyuanzi paused before continuing, “But later, thanks to the good fortune bestowed by a predecessor, it now requires only one yuanhui to bear a crop, and there are but twelve fruits each time. The effects of the fruit have surpassed what they once were: a single whiff can extend one’s lifespan by thirty-six hundred years, and eating one will increase your cultivation by a whole yuanhui. As for the other marvels, you must discover them for yourself.”

Zhenyuanzi smiled at Hongyun and fell silent.

“Oh? Such a wondrous fruit exists? Then I must have a taste!” Without further ado, Hongyun picked up a ginseng fruit and began to eat.

Suddenly, a surge of magic power rippled through Hongyun. A peculiar resonance of the Dao emanated from his body. After finishing the fruit, he closed his eyes in contemplation.
